Doribax (doripenem injection), FDA-Approved for Complicated Urinary Tract and Intra-abdominal Infections
Filed in archive Bacteria and Bacterial Infections , FDA Approvals , Treatment on October 18, 2007
Currently, the prescribed medication for the treatment of complicated urinary tract infections is levofloxacin while meropenem for complicated intra-abdominal infections.

Found to have a cure rate comparable to levofloxacin and meropenem and have been shown to be active against several strains of bacteria - Doribax (doripenem injection, 500 mg intravenous infusion) - has recently approved by the FDA for the treatment of complicated urinary tract infections and intra-abdominal infections.
Doribax is a product of Johnson and Johnson Pharmaceutical Research and Development, LLC.

There are a variety of different types of foreign bacterial infections one can get from many different sources, yet some are more common than others. If they are not beneficial for your physiology, they all should die in order to restore your health.
Strept infections are caused by what are called gram positive bacteria, and are unique that these bacteria grow in pairs. Staph bacterial invasions are gram positive as well, yet it is the MRSA, Methicillin Resistant Staff Aureous microbes of this type often are very difficult to treat normally when a patient suffers from their damage from being invaded by these bacteria. Another difficult situation is when a patient is infected by VRE, Vancomycin Resistant Enterococci, bacteria as well.
These MRSA and VRE pathogenic or disease causing bacteria are the ones that are the mos clinically concerning for the health care provider.
Group A strep infections can cause diseases such as strep throat and pneumonia. Since there are several types of bacteria, a diagnostic test called a culture and sensitivity is usually performed to assure the correct antibiotic is selected for treatment, as the bacteria are identified with this method.
Typically, fluid from the area suspected of being infected is obtained from the patient suspected to have an infection and smeared on what is called a petrie dish. And then these dishes are incubated for 2 to 3 days. Gram positive bacteria stain during this process a dark violet or blue. Gram negative bacteria would be pink in color, and are capable of harm as well to a human being.
When the culture is complete, technology offers recommendations on the appropriate class or brand of antibiotic for this bacteria present in another person- presuming the bacteria will not be resistant to the antibiotic recommended, as this happens on occasion.
Usually, classes of antibiotics that are used to treat gram positive strep infections that are not VRE or MRSA are cephalosporins, macrolides, or general penicillins. If the microbe that is causing the infection is resistant to the antibiotic from such classes that are administered to the infected patient, particularly with methicillin and vancomycin, which is the case with VRE and MRSA bacteria, then there are other more aggressive antibiotics that will be chosen for this patient.
Such brands and types of antibiotics for MRSA and VRE bacteria include Zyvox, which has both IV and oral dosage options. There are also other antibiotics, such as cubicin. However these antibiotics for antibiotic resistant bacteria are given usually due to infections that have progressed to a more serious nature within a patient infected in such a way.
Progressive medical conditions include sepsis, or blood infection, osteomyelitis, or bone infection, or Pneumonia, which is a serious lung infection. A hospital stay is normally required with such patients, as the last antibiotics mentioned for MRSA and VRE bacterial infections are given by IV administration initially for several days, if not several weeks.
There are numerous classes and types of antibiotics available, yet bacterial resistance to most of these antibiotics constantly remains serious concern for the health care provider, and the infected patient, with MRSA at the top of the list of concerns for the health care providers.
